Introduction:

The social and psychological development of children and infants involve development of relationships, personality, and sense of being female or male. All these processes start in infancy and continue in many respects till adulthood. Attachment is an emotional bond which occurs between an infant and a mother or a primary care. It is an essential development in the case of emotional and social life of the infant that develops in the first 6 months of their life and showing up in different ways in the second 6 months.

Ainsworth devised a design for the measurement of attachments of an infant to the mother or caregiver, is termed as “strange situation”. This technique determined four types of attachment styles: secure, avoidant, ambivalent, and disorganized-disoriented.
